NG400CP0 Bearing Product Overview & Core Advantages
The NG400CP0 is a precision thin-section ball bearing engineered for applications requiring exceptional dimensional stability and reliable performance. Featuring a single row design with an open construction, this bearing is optimized to handle substantial radial loads while maintaining a minimal cross-section. Its Endura-kote chromium plating provides superior corrosion resistance, making it an ideal choice for demanding environments. The bearing is pre-lubricated for immediate use and adheres to ABEC-1 precision tolerances, ensuring consistent operation and high reliability in precision assemblies.
NG400CP0 Bearing Model Code Explained, Specifications & Naming Convention
| Code Segment | Technical Meaning |
|---|---|
| NG400 | Indicates the bearing series and size designation (40" bore, 42" OD, 1" width). |
| C | Signifies the Endura-kote Chromium Plating for enhanced surface hardness and corrosion resistance. |
| P | Denotes ABEC-1 Precision Class, ensuring tight dimensional control for smooth, accurate operation. |
| 0 | Specifies an Open (unsealed) design, allowing for custom lubrication schemes or operation in clean environments. |
NG400CP0 Bearing Structural Features & Performance Benefits
This bearing's performance is derived from its robust material selection and precise engineering. The use of chrome steel for both rings and balls provides high load capacity and durability, with a dynamic radial load rating of 18,307 lbf and an impressive static radial load rating of 67,310 lbf. The brass cage ensures stable ball guidance, contributing to smooth rotation and reduced noise. The thin-section design allows for significant space and weight savings in large-diameter applications without compromising strength. The specified radial internal clearance (0.0000 – 0.0005") is tightly controlled for optimal performance under load. The chromium plating not only resists corrosion but also reduces friction and wear, extending service life.
NG400CP0 Bearing Typical Application Areas
The NG400CP0 is suited for a variety of large-scale, precision industrial equipment. Common applications include: Aerospace positioning systems, large rotary tables in manufacturing, medical imaging equipment gantries, robotic arms with large joints, and precision radar and satellite communication systems. Its combination of a large bore, thin section, and corrosion-resistant coating makes it particularly valuable in applications where space, weight, and environmental resistance are critical design factors.
